1. ALICE Technologies – Generative AI for Scheduling Optimization

Type: Paid

Best for: Large projects with complex scheduling

Managing a large-scale construction project is like solving a complex puzzle blindfolded—and every delay costs real money. ALICE Technologies helps you see that puzzle clearly.

This tool simulates thousands of potential build sequences by analyzing variables like weather, material lead times, and labor availability, helping you choose the most efficient path forward.

What it does:

  • Uses generative AI to evaluate different sequencing options
  • Factors in real-site constraints are dynamically
  • Simulates the impact of changes before you commit

Real-world use:

A major contractor using ALICE on a $200M rail project cut five months from the schedule just by adjusting the build logic. That’s tangible time and cost savings.

Why it’s valuable:

You don’t have to guess which path is fastest. ALICE gives you the data so you can build smarter from day one.

2. Buildots – AI-Powered Progress Tracking from On-Site Cameras

Type: Paid

Best for: Commercial construction firms tracking schedule slippage

Manual progress updates are slow and often optimistic. Buildots takes unbiased jobsite footage and compares it to BIM models, providing real-time insights into whether crews are meeting milestones or falling behind.

Key features:

  • Converts hardhat camera footage into insight-rich visuals
  • Maps actual progress against the project schedule
  • Automatically identifies clashes or delays

Use case:

One contractor reduced project management overhead by 20% after using Buildots to detect and address slippage days after it happened—not weeks.

Why it’s valuable:

You have instant, visual confirmation of what’s complete and what’s lagging—without walking every floor yourself.

 

3. Procore + Smartvid.io – AI Safety Monitoring and Risk Forecasting

Type: Paid (add-on)

Best for: Safety teams on complex job sites

Even with site protocols in place, risks still slip through. Smartvid.io integrates directly with your existing Procore pipeline, scanning jobsite photos and videos for unsafe behaviors and risk trends that you might not spot in the daily report.

What it does:

  • Flags PPE noncompliance, unsafe equipment usage, and more
  • Analyzes historical data to predict safety hotspots
  • Alerts you before violations happen

Unique insight:

It doesn’t just “see” safety issues—it connects the dots and shows you where the next accident is most likely if nothing changes.

Why it matters:

The payoff is clear: fewer incidents, stronger compliance records, and safer teams.

 

4. Doxel – Autonomous Jobsite Monitoring via Robotics and AI

Type: Paid

Best for: Tech-forward contractors managing high-stakes projects

Doxel replaces countless site walks with autonomous ground rovers that scan your jobsite daily. Those scans are then analyzed against models using AI to catch out-of-tolerance work or schedule drift before it becomes a costly punch list.

Capabilities include:

  • Daily 3D scans without crew intervention
  • Automatic variance detection
  • Dashboards highlighting at-risk areas

Use case:

A healthcare facility project reduced its total costs by 11% after Doxel identified framing errors early, thereby avoiding expensive downstream fixes.

Why it’s powerful:

You’re catching errors proactively—every day—without burning labor hours to do it.

 

5. OpenSpace.ai – Automated Site Documentation

Type: Free trial + Paid

Best for: Firms needing fast site documentation + accountability

Documenting progress is a necessary chore—until it becomes a high-stakes legal issue. OpenSpace helps you record every square foot accurately with AI-tagged 360-degree photo walks.

What it solves:

  • Creates a searchable, time-stamped site history
  • Auto-links visuals to plans and schedules
  • Makes disputes over scope or timeline much easier to resolve

Pro tip:

Use it during inspections or pay apps to verify work completion fast. It adds a layer of visual truth to every conversation.

 

6. Pillar – AI for Preconstruction & RFIs

Type: Paid

Best for: Estimators and VDC teams in design-heavy projects

Preconstruction often encounters bottlenecks due to slow RFI turnaround times or vague specifications. Pillar transforms documents and project correspondence into structured, searchable data using natural language processing (NLP).

What it offers:

  • Auto-generates RFI responses using project context
  • Flags conflicting or risky language automatically
  • Sorts past RFIs by topic or system for quick reference

Use it for:

Keeping preconstruction moving when you’re under tight deadlines from owners or pricing complex scopes across trades.

What most people miss is:

AI doesn’t just move faster—it reads more carefully than a rushed human eye, catching wording that could trigger change orders or claims later.

 

7. Toggle – Robot-Assisted Rebar Assembly Using AI

Type: Paid

Best for: Concrete firms doing repetitive rebar projects

Toggle drives AI-powered robots that assist with rebar layout and assembly, making prefab and field installation faster and safer.

What it delivers:

  • Speeds up shop production 5x
  • Cuts physical strain and injury risk for field crews
  • Advances in installation precision, reducing field fixes

Case study:

Contractors using Toggle reduced labor costs by as much as 50% on large foundation projects by automating heavy-lift rebar work.

Key takeaway:

You’re not swapping out workers—you’re giving your skilled team mechanical muscle to do more with less effort.

 

8. Pype (by Autodesk Construction Cloud) – AI Contract Review

Type: Paid

Best for: General contractors dealing with complex subcontracts

Contract fine print tends to surface at the worst time. Pype uses AI to comb through specs and contracts, automatically pulling out requirements, milestones, and due dates you need to stay compliant.

Core features:

  • Extracts key clauses and dates in seconds
  • Syncs with project workflows
  • Sends alerts when obligations are approaching

Why it’s worth it:

You avoid costly oversights buried in paperwork—and your team gets clarity without legal bottlenecks slowing down the build.

 

9. PlanRadar – AI-Driven Defect Detection & Communication

Type: Free trial + Paid

Best for: Punch list management and multi-stakeholder projects

Punch list chaos happens when communication breaks down. PlanRadar uses lightweight AI to streamline inspection workflows by tagging issues by location, attaching photos or voice notes, and tracking resolution.

What it helps with:

  • Room-specific snag lists organized by trade
  • Real-time status on fixes
  • Auto-suggestions based on past job issues

Example usage:

Ideal for unit-based construction like hotels or apartments, where multiple rooms are inspected simultaneously and tracked through to handover.

 

10. Bricks + Agent – AI for Maintenance in Property Asset Construction

Type: Free + Paid tiers

Best for: Construction firms with FM or O&M components

If your scope includes facilities maintenance or you do O&M handoffs post-build, 

Bricks + Agent manages service lifecycles with predictive AI. It routes work orders, communicates with tenants, and flags likely failures based on historical asset performance.

Key benefits:

  • Forecasts system issues like HVAC outages
  • Auto-prioritizes tasks for limited technician time
  • Cuts response times by as much as half

Think of it as:

Your 24/7 facilities help desk that scales with your project count.
